Hadith refers to the recorded sayings, actions, and approvals of the Prophet Muhammad ﷺ. These narrations are a key source of Islamic knowledge after the Qur’an. They guide Muslims in worship, character, and daily life. Each hadith shows how the Prophet ﷺ lived and taught the message of Islam in practical ways.

Hadith collections like Sahih al-Bukhari and Sahih Muslim have preserved these narrations with great care. Scholars classify hadiths based on their authenticity and chain of narration. Sahih al-Bukhari 7147 (Book 97, Hadith 58)

Sahih al-Bukhari 7147 (Book 97, Hadith 58) Narrated Ibn `Abbas: Allah’s Messenger (ﷺ) used to say at the time of difficulty, “None has the right to be worshipped but Allah, the Majestic, the Most Forbearing.
